The purpose of the FLOW Aquatics Stroke School program is to further develop and refine freestyle and backstroke technique as well as learn stroke technique for butterfly, breaststroke, starts and turns, as well as work on maintaining technique while swimming longer distances.
We focus on balance, body position, alignment in every stroke before adding in the arms. Our main goal is to practice perfectly for short distances with many repetitions before we start working on endurance culminating in a 10-minute swim. Our concern is proper technique over distance or speed. Endurance and speed will be touched on in our Swim Team Classes.

All Stages have Corresponding Bracelet Colors (in parenthesis)
Focus: Freestyle
Skills learned: Proper head and body position, proper kick, rotation of hips, arm recovery and catch, and breath timing.
Focus: Backstroke
Skills learned: Proper head and body position, proper kick, rotation of hips, arm recovery and catch, and breath timing. Continued work on freestyle endurance.
Focus: Butterfly
Skills learned: Proper head and body position, proper kick, arm recovery and catch, and breath timing. Continued work on freestyle and backstroke endurance.
Focus: Breaststroke
Skills learned: Proper head and body position, proper kick, arm recovery and catch, and breath timing. Continued work on freestyle, backstroke and butterfly endurance.
Focus: Starts, Turns, IM (Individual Medley) and Endurance
Skills learned: Proper turns for IM, freestyle and backstroke flip turns, starts, underwater pullouts, IM and endurance (10 minute swim non-stop).
